Samsung Galaxy A42 has a general score of 87, which is much better than LG K61's general score of 77.6. The Samsung Galaxy A42 design is a little bit thicker and a little bit heavier than the LG K61. Both of these phones use Android OS (operating system), but the Samsung Galaxy A42 has the older 11 version while LG K61 has Android 9.0 Pie version.
The LG K61 has a brighter display than Galaxy A42,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a better pixels density and a much better 1080 x 2340 resolution. The LG K61 features a bit faster processing unit than Samsung Galaxy A42. Both have a Octa-Core CPU and a 4 GB RAM.
The Galaxy A42 shoots greater photos and videos than LG K61, and although they both have a same resolution back camera, the Galaxy A42 also has a way higher (4K) video quality. LG K61 has more storage capacity to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y A42, and although they both have equal 128 GB internal storage, the LG K61 also has a SD memory slot that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B.
Samsung Galaxy A42 counts with longer battery duration than LG K61, because it has a 25 percent more battery size.
